Biological Delivery Systems
Pathogens have adapted to precisely introduce nucleic acids into target cells, making them an effective tool for DNA-based treatment. Frequently employed virus-based carriers consist of:
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both proliferating and quiescent cells but can elicit immunogenic reactions.
Parvovirus-based carriers – Preferred due to their lower immunogenicity and potential to ensure extended DNA transcription.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the host genome,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viral vectors being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.
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ods
Alternative gene transport techniques present a less immunogenic choice, diminishing adverse immunogenic effects. These encompass: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ging DNA or RNA for targeted cellular uptake.
Electropulse Gene Transfer – Using electrical pulses to open transient channels in plasma barriers,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.
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into localized cells.

The Science Behind Cell and Gene Therapies
Regenerative Cell Therapy: Revolutionizing Treatment Options
Living cell therapy leverages the regenerative potential of biological structures to heal medical issues. Key instances involve:
Hematopoietic Stem Cell Grafts:
Used to treat leukemia, lymphoma, and other blood disorders by infusing healthy stem cells through regenerative cell injections.
CAR-T Immunotherapy: A transformative tumor-targeting approach in which a individual’s white blood cells are reprogrammed to target with precision and combat malignant cells.
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y: Investigated for its clinical applications in mitigating chronic immune dysfunctions, musculoskeletal damage, and neurological diseases.
Genetic Engineering Solutions: Altering the Genetic Blueprint
Gene therapy achieves results by repairing the fundamental issue of chromosomal abnormalities:
Direct Genetic Therapy: Delivers therapeutic genes directly into the biological structure, including the clinically endorsed Luxturna for managing inherited blindness.
External Genetic Modification: Utilizes modifying a individual’s tissues externally and then implanting them, as applied in some clinical trials for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une deficiencies.
The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has greatly enhanced gene therapy scientific exploration, making possible precise modifications at the genetic scale.
